Potted as three conjoined ovoid vases with cylindrical necks, the bodies rising from a short trefoil foot, applied overall with with a crushed raspberry-red glaze, thinning at the mouth rims and streaking towards the foot, the unglazed foot ring surrounding the crackle-glazed foot.
Property from the Currier Museum of Art, Manchester, New Hampshire.
